Important Safety Instructions
Please read the following instructions and notices before using your tablet.
1. Avoid using in extremely hot, cold, dusty, damp or wet environments.
2. Excessive use of earphones at high volume may lead to hearing impairment. Limit earphone usage, and adjust the volume to a moderate level only. Do not use the tablet while walking or driving.
3. Do not suddenly disconnect the tablet when formatting, uploading or downloading data. This may lead to program errors (e.g. system of screen “freezing”.)
4. If the AC adapter, AC cord or provided cables become damaged in any way, stop using them immediately. Failure to do so may cause the tablet to malfunction, or corrupt files and/or memory.
5. Dismantling the tablet will void the manufacturer’s warranty and may present the risk of hazard. If you are experiencing problems, review the Troubleshooting section of this manual or call Customer Support.
6. Warning: This product may contain a chemical known to the State of California to cause cancer, birth defects, or other reproductive harm.
7. Improper use of the battery may result in explosion. Review the Battery Care section in this manual to charge the tablet battery safely.
8. The touch screen is made of glass. Avoid dropping or forcibly placing the tablet onto a hard surface. Do not use alcohol, thinner or benzene to clean the surface of the tablet. This may damage the screen or internal electronic components and void warranty.
9. Do not use over-loaded, non-standard power sources or any power cable that does not come with your device.
10. Tablet functions, hardware, software and warranty information may be revised by the manufacturer or their respective owners, and are subject to change without notice.

Starting your Tablet
Power On/Off/Standby Mode ON: Press and hold the side POWER button on the side for about 3 seconds until the
logo screen appears, then release. OFF: Press and hold the side POWER button until the POWER OFF window appears, then slide down to turn off. STANDBY MODE: While the Tablet is on, press the side POWER button quickly to power off the display only. The Tablet will enter a sleep mode which minimizes some of the battery functions (turn off completely to avoid unnecessary battery drainage). Press the POWER button quickly to wake from sleep mode so that you can use the Tablet immediately. NOTE: Another way to access Power, Shut Down, or Update and Restart is to swipe left from the right edge of the screen and tap SETTINGS.
Starting your Tablet
First time Setup
Setup runs the first time you power on your Tablet. During setup you’ll choose a language, color scheme, and name, all of which can be change at a later time.
User and Password Setup
Swipe inward at left edge of display to call up the Charm Menu. When a password is required, you can choose one to sign in. Here’s how:
1. Swipe inward from the left edge of the display to call up the Charm Menu. Open the SETTINGS charm, then tap or click PC settings > Accounts > Sign-in options.
2. Under Password policy, choose an item from the list: Microsoft account: Choose a time frame or to Always require a password. Local account: Choose a time frame, Always require a password, or Never require a password.
NOTE: Password policy setting may not be available if you’ve added a work email account to the Mail app.
Charging the Battery
Connect the power adapter to a wall outlet, then to the Tablet as shown. It is recommended to fully charge the battery before first use. A battery status indicator appears in the lower left corner. Tap the battery icon to view percentage of remaining power.
NOTE: It takes approximately 2-3 hours to fully recharge the battery from a depleted state. It is normal for the tablet to feel warm while recharging and during use. Actual play times will vary depending on display settings, apps that remain open, and your internet usage.
Charging the Battery
Battery Care Operating temperature: Your Tablet is designed to work between 32°F and 95°F (or 0°C to 35°C). Lithium-ion batteries are sensitive to higher temperatures. Keep your Tablet out of direct sun light and don’t leave it in a closed environment susceptible to extreme temperatures. Recharge anytime: we recommend discharging the battery down to 10% or lower level at least once each month before you recharge it.
